Why were steamboats an improvement over earlier forms of transportation,
such as horses and wagons?
O A. They required less power to operate.
O B. They cost more to operate.
O C. They could carry fewer people.
O D. They could carry more goods.

Answers

Answer:

D. They could carry more goods.

Explanation:

Steamboats played a vital role in opening the west and south to further settlement. They stimulated the agricultural economy of the west by providing better access to markets at a lower cost. Farmers quickly bought land near navigable rivers, because they could now easily ship their produce out. Steamboat River Transport. Steamboats proved a popular method of commercial and passenger transportation along the Mississippi River and other inland U.S. rivers in the 19th century. Their relative speed and ability to travel against the current reduced the time and expense of shipping. n the years before the Civil War, the steamboat replaced horse-drawn wagons as the most efficient way to transport goods and people throughout the United States. Steamboats made it possible to cheaply ship freight to the port of New Orleans from as far away as Pittsburgh and New York.

The Munich Pact, agreed to in the 1930s, favored A. Germany B. England C. USSR​

Answers

Answer:

A. Germany

Explanation:

In the spring of 1938, Hitler began openly to support the demands of German-speakers living in the Sudeten region of Czechoslovakia for closer ties with Germany. Hitler had recently annexed Austria into Germany, and the conquest of Czechoslovakia was the next step in his plan of creating a greater Germany.
